Job Description

We are seeking a dedicated and skilled Woodworking Machine Setter to join our team. The role involves safely and efficiently operating woodworking machinery to ensure high-quality production and adherence to safety standards.

Responsibilities

  • Operate CNC machines and other woodworking tools.
  • Monitor machine operations to ensure proper functionality.
  • Train junior staff on machine operation and safety protocols.
  • Prepare materials and adjust machinery for various woodworking tasks.
  • Perform quality checks and maintain production logs.
  • Implement safety measures and report hazards.
  • Assist in inventory management of materials.
